plc ye step motor surucusu baglama

Katılım
20 Tem 2009
Mesajlar
53
Puanları
1
iyi günler elimde
Parker / Digiplan PK2 - In Stock, We Buy Sell Repair, Price Quote
step motor surucusu var delta sa2 ye bunu baglayıp kontrol etmek ıstıyorum bu cıhazdan gören bilen plc ya baglayan oldumu nasıl baglayacagım yardımı dokunan olursa sevınırım ınternetten manuelıne baktım anlayamadım yardımcı olursanız sevınırım
 
KNX Standardı, küçük bir rezidansın içerisindeki aydınlatma, perde panjur, klima kontrolünden, Dünya’nın en büyük havalimanlarındaki aydınlatma otomasyonu gibi çözümler için tercih edilen bir Dünya standardıdır.
Yazımızda endüstrinin can damarı sayılabilecek PLC’yi inceleyeceğiz.
Merhaba,

Linkteki bağlantı örneğini referans amaçlı takip inceleyebilirsiniz.
PLC tarafındaki bağlantı çokta farklı olmayacaktır. (UP,ZP,Y0,Y1)

https://www.kontrolkalemi.com/forum...kumanlar/73052-plc-step-motor-baglantisi.html

Sizin bahsettiğiniz sürücü aşağıdaki dokümandaki gibi ise orada +12V belirtiliyor.
http://www.parkermotion.com/manuals/PK2.pdf

Bu nedenle Y0,Y1 çıkışlarına seri 500ohm (çeyrek watt) direnç kullanmanız tavsiye olunur.

Birde alternatif bilgi olarak, PLC çıkışlarının sıfırı (ZP) ile Sürücü girişleri sıfırı (0V) birleştirip pulse ile sürmeyi deneyebilirsiniz.

İyi çalışmalar.
 
cok sagolun desteklerinizin cok faydasını goruyorum
sizede iyi calısmalar
 
imdat bey plc zp cıkısı ıle sürücünün 0 volt girişini birlestirdim y0 cıkısınada 2 kohm direnc bagladım sürücünün clk in girisine baglayıp dip sivicini actım
programıda
ld x0 -------set m0
ld x1 -------rst m0
ld m0------ mov k10000 d50
ld m0 ------ mov k5000 d60
ld m0 ------ dplsy d50 d60 y0
olarak yazdım plc y0 cıkısı x0 cıkısına basıldıgında bır anlık yanıyor o anda step motordan bir anlık buzzer (inleme) sesı gelıyor 1 adım ileri geri yapıp( asenkron motorda faza kalma gibi ) duruyor
aynı komutların don satırını degiştirip
ld m0------dplsv d50 y0 y1 yaptıgımda ıse motor surekli buzzer ( inleme) sesi yaptı sebebi sürücü ile alakalımıdır benmı yanlız bır komut yazıyorum
ilginiz icin teşekkürler
 
sürücünün kulanım klavuzunda
Input frequency range 47 - 63Hz

Minimum motor inductance 1mH
Nominal chopping freq. 15kHz
yazıyor
sa2 kulanım klavuzunda 32khz yazıyor bu benım bu sürücüye baglıyamıcagım anlamına mı gelıyor bırde yukarda yazdıgım gıbı programlaya bılıyormuyum step motorları
tekrar teşekkürler
 
Merhaba,

DPLSV D50 Y0 Y1 komutu kullandığınızda D50=10000 ise Y0 çıkışından 10kHZ'de pulse çıkışı sürekli olarak verir.

Daha düşük frekanslarda tepkilerine bakabilirsiniz. Step motorlar servolardan çok daha düşük pulse frekanslarında kontrol edilirler.

İyi çalışmalar.
 
sürücünün kulanım klavuzunda
Input frequency range 47 - 63Hz

Minimum motor inductance 1mH
Nominal chopping freq. 15kHz
yazıyor
sa2 kulanım klavuzunda 32khz yazıyor bu benım bu sürücüye baglıyamıcagım anlamına mı gelıyor bırde yukarda yazdıgım gıbı programlaya bılıyormuyum step motorları
tekrar teşekkürler
merhaba imdat bey
47 - 63 hz i ben khz olarak okumdum ben tekrar deniyeyim ilginiz ve bilgileriniz için cok teşekkürler
 
ld x0 -------set m0
ld x1 -------rst m0
ld m0------ mov k10000 d50
ld m0 ------ mov k5000 d60
ld m0 ------ dplsy d50 d60 y0
bu komut bulogu neden bır anlık cıkıs verdı pekı imdat bey gerci bir komutu ogrendıkten sonra dıgerlerınıde kavramak sıkıntı degıl ama yardımlarınız hem burdan hemde sitenizden cok faydalı oluyor

 
Merhaba,

DPLSY D50 D60 Y0 olarak çalıştırdığınızda D50=10000 D60=5000 ise;
10kHz'de 5000 adet pulse üretir. Dolayısıyla hızlıca belirtilen adet kadar pulse üretip görevini tamamlayacaktır.

PLSY komutu ile SV/SV2/SA2/SS2/SX2/SE PLC 'lerde sürekli pulse çıkışı almak istiyorsanız 2.parametresi olan pulse adedi değeri=0 olmalı.

İyi çalışmalar.
 

Forum istatistikleri

Konular
128,169
Mesajlar
915,621
Kullanıcılar
449,934
Son üye
peldayilmaz

Yeni konular

Geri
Üst